According to perceptual symbol systems theory, bottom-up patterns of activation within sensory-motor areas become associated during perception, and thus become perceptually-based symbols. . [p7] This article should show that perceptual symbol systems can: [p8] represent types and tokens combine symbols productively to produce new conceptual structures (ball + snow = snowball) bind types to tokens for propositions represent abstract concepts Perceptual symbols are interpreted-- not just recorded from life. Barsalou and Prinz provide three general arguments for their claim that cognition is handled by a perceptual symbol system: one that straightforwardly appeals to recent empirical results, a second that extols to the general advantages of perceptual symbols, and a third that attacks the empirical basis for amodal symbols.
